Obituary for Michelle Ann Urdzik

Funeral services for Michelle Ann (nee Smith) Urdzik, 50, of Eastlake, will be 11 a.m. Wednesday at Willoughby United Methodist Church, 15 Public Square, Willoughby. (Family and friends are asked to please meet at church.)
Michelle passed away Saturday, Dec. 2, 2017, at her residence in Eastlake.
Born July 12, 1967, in Willoughby, she was raised in Lake County and had lived in Richmond Heights before moving back to Lake County a little over two years ago.
Michelle enjoyed crafts, artwork and crocheting. She was a Rainbow Girl, a big animal lover, loved Florida and was a “beach girl.”
She was the wife of Mark A. Tamburrino; former wife of David Urdzik; loving mother of Brittney L. (Mike) Bajc; daughter of Charles L. and Darlene J. (nee Slapnicker) Smith; sister of Charles E. (Larayne) Smith; and aunt of Emily Smith (Ken), Drew (Natalie) Smith, and Blake (Cristina) Smith. She also leaves her dog, “Domino.”
Family will receive friends from 4 to 8 p.m. Tuesday at The Abbey of Willoughby, 38011 Euclid Ave. (located on the grounds of McMahon-Coyne-Vitantonio Funeral Home), in Willoughby. Burial will be in Acacia Park Cemetery in Mayfield Heights.
Contributions in her name may be made to the Lake County Humane Society, 7564 Tyler Blvd., Mentor, OH 44060.
